Transaction 51792e106f95f2159510287afc35c191d5585014e249660fb4c7e894a5d2ec61

1 Input
2 Outputs
  • 51792e106f95f2159510287afc35c191d5585014e249660fb4c7e894a5d2ec61:0
  • value  875225
    address  1MNZRbW1xznztQXWWdPhdKjigc2z8t2sVP
  • 51792e106f95f2159510287afc35c191d5585014e249660fb4c7e894a5d2ec61:1
  • value  15621690
    address  1DcN1opV2Rrgy9qQpkWpWjHo5EKpgoqVMp